The UEFA Champions League third qualifying round first leg between Aarhus (AGF) and Sabah Baku kicks off today at approximately 19:30 local time (check your timezone for exact kick-off). This is a high-stakes European clash that pits the newly crowned Danish champions against the reigning Azerbaijani title holders. Fans searching for today football match prediction, head to head football stats and today football match livescore will find a complete, up-to-date guide here covering form, key players, tactical outlook, predicted scoreline and how to follow the action live.
Aarhus host the match at Cepheus Park Randers (also referred to as AutoC Park or similar neutral venue in Randers) because their regular home ground does not currently meet UEFA stadium requirements. The return leg is scheduled for 11 August in Azerbaijan. This is the first-ever competitive meeting between the two clubs, so pure head-to-head history is zero – making recent European form, domestic momentum and individual player impact the most reliable indicators.

Team Form and Recent Results
Aarhus (AGF) Recent Form
Aarhus enter this tie as Danish Superliga champions, ending a long wait for domestic silverware. Their European campaign so far has been dramatic. In the previous qualifying round they lost the first leg 1-4 at home to Lech Poznań, then produced a remarkable 4-1 (or 4-3 depending on exact reporting of the aggregate path) away win and advanced via penalties. That fightback has given the squad huge belief.
Domestic results around the European ties have been mixed but resilient: a 1-1 draw with Brøndby and a 2-2 draw at Lyngby. Across their last several competitive matches, Aarhus have frequently seen both teams score and have shown the ability to score first. Kristian Arnstad has been particularly influential, finding the net in multiple recent outings (including penalties). The side under Jakob Poulsen plays with intensity and width, which could suit the wider pitch dimensions at the neutral venue.
Sabah Baku Recent Form
Sabah arrive with an impressive perfect record in this season’s Champions League qualifying. They defeated The New Saints 4-1 on aggregate (2-0 home, 2-1 away) and then eliminated Finnish side KuPS 3-0 on aggregate (1-0 home, 2-0 away). Goalkeeper Stas Pokatilov has kept multiple clean sheets, and the side has looked organised and clinical. Veljko Simić has been a standout with goal involvements, often striking in the middle third of matches. Joy-Lance Mickels and Kaheem Parris provide additional attacking threat.
Domestically, Sabah are Azerbaijani champions and have shown consistency. Their European run so far suggests a disciplined defensive structure combined with the ability to punish opponents on the counter or from set pieces. However, several sources note that clean sheets have been harder to keep in some away fixtures outside pure qualifying wins.

Tactical Outlook and What to Expect
Aarhus are expected to take the initiative on “home” soil (even if neutral). Their style tends toward high pressing, physicality and creating overloads in wide areas. After the emotional high of the Lech comeback, confidence is high, but defensive fragility has been visible in recent draws where both teams scored.
Sabah are likely to stay compact, look to frustrate Aarhus, and strike on the break or from set pieces. Their qualifying record shows they can keep clean sheets and still score. The midfield battle and how well Sabah deal with Aarhus’s intensity will be decisive. Yellow card trends have been noted in Sabah’s European games (often over 2.5 cards), so discipline could play a role.
Weather and pitch conditions at Cepheus Park should be favourable for open football. Expect an energetic start from the Danish side and a measured, organised response from the visitors.
